Woman's Nose Poked With Key Fob, Man, 34, Arrested: JPD
The early morning domestic violence happened at a Joliet house in the 500 block of North William Street, Joliet police announced.

JOLIET, IL — A 34-year-old Joliet man who poked a woman in the face with a car key fob, injuring her nose, is no longer in Will County's Jail after posting 10 percent of his $20,000 bail over the weekend, according to Joliet police reports.
Rene Alonzo Jr., who comes from the 500 block of North William Street, was arrested early Friday morning on charges of domestic battery and interfering with the reporting of domestic violence
Around 12:40 a.m., Joliet police were called Alonzo's place after officers learned that Alonzo beat up a woman he was romantically involved with, according to police reports.

"During an argument, Alonzo struck the victim in the face with a car key fob, causing injury to the victim’s nose," police spokesman Dwayne English said. "Alonzo also pulled the victim’s hair and slapped her in the face multiple times."
Alonzo then left the residence, but returned a short time later, police reports show.

Officers placed Alonzo into custody without any problems, and Alonzo's victim refused medical assistance, English noted.
